What is Manitoba DB Agreement

The Manitoba Online Database Agreement is a legal document used by individuals or entities in Manitoba to access Government of Manitoba databases while indemnifying the Government and IBM from claims.

What is the Manitoba Online Database Agreement?

The Manitoba Online Database Agreement is a crucial legal document for accessing Government of Manitoba databases. It establishes a framework for data use, ensuring end users are aware of their responsibilities and the legal implications involved.
This agreement serves as a safeguard, providing clarity regarding the data access rights and obligations of the users. It is essential for individuals and organizations in Canada that rely on government databases for information and services.

Key Features of the Manitoba Online Database Agreement

The Manitoba Online Database Agreement comprises several key components that outline the expectations of all parties involved. Essential features include detailed indemnification clauses which protect the government from liabilities arising from data use.
Furthermore, the document contains various fillable fields that require user input, such as name, title, and date. It is vital for users to pay attention to signing requirements, ensuring their entries are accurate and complete.
